Wyoming is about 1.4 times bigger than North Dakota.
North Dakota is approximately 178,647 sq km, while Wyoming is approximately 251,489 sq km, making Wyoming 41% larger than North Dakota. Meanwhile, the population of North Dakota is ~672,591 people (108,965 fewer people live in Wyoming).
